Built to withstand the rigors of the trail, the Konus 8x42 Emperor OH Binoculars feature a textured rubber armored exterior and nitrogen-filled optical tubes to give them a slip-resistant grip with water and fogproof performance. Their open-bridge configuration reduces the weight without sacrificing strength while giving the hand a larger gripping surface.
Complementing the sturdy build is a 65° wide-angle field of view. The Emperor has anti-reflection fully multicoated optics and phase-corrected BAK4 roof prisms that produce bright and clear high-contrast views with true color rendition. The larger objectives increase the light-gathering ability for use at dawn and dusk or in areas with a thick canopy.
